This Wednesday, a teaser trailer was released for ‘The Spongebob Movie: Search for Squarepants’. It will be the fourth theatrical movie released in the SpongeBob series. In 2022, developments for the film were announced by Brian Robbins, Chief Content Officer for Paramount + in addition to several spinoff movies. After having to pull the previous film ‘The Spongebob Movie: Sponge on the Run’ due to the pandemic, this movie will be highly anticipated. Earlier films in the Spongebob franchise have grossed close to $471 million worldwide.
According to IGN, the plot of the movie will be as follows. “Desperate to be a big guy, SpongeBob sets out to prove his bravery to Mr. Krabs by following The Flying Dutchman – a mysterious swashbuckling ghost pirate – on a seafaring comedy-adventure that takes him to the deepest depths of the deep sea, where no Sponge has gone before.
Former creative director for the SpongeBob tv series Derek Dymon is set to direct the film. The screenplay was written by Pam Brady and Matt Lieberman; the plot was created by Marc Ceccarelli, Kaz, and Brady.
Cast of ‘The SpongeBob Movie: Search for Squarepants’
Main cast members include Tom Kenny as SpongeBob, Clancy Brown as Mr. Krabs, and Rodger Bumpass as Squidward. Others include Bill Fagerbakke as Patrick , Carolyn Lawrence as Sandy Cheeks, and Mr. Lawrence as Plankton. George Lopez, Isis “Ice Spice” Gaston, Arturo Castro, Sherry Cola, and Regina Hall will make appearances as well. Mark Hamill will portray The Flying Dutchman.
Rapper Ice Spice will contribute a song to the soundtrack with John Debney returning to develop film score. In addition to this, animated short film will be released jointly ‘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: Chrome Alone 2 – Lost in New Jersey.’
The film will be releasing in theaters on December 19, 2025. Follow for more news at Famease Media.
